CARIA. Antioch ad Maeandrum. Circa 85-65/60 BC. Tetradrachm (Silver, 26 mm, 16.20 g, 12 h), Diotrephes, magistrate 'for the third time'. Laureate head of Apollo to right with bow and quiver over his shoulder. Rev. ANTIOXЄΩN - ΔIOTPЄΦΗC / TOTPITON Zebu bull standing left; all within maeander pattern. BMC -. HN online 1528.
